Cycurion Makes It Clear: Issues Litigation Hold Letters to 16 Market Makers as Company Aggressively Investigates Potential Harm to Shareholders
MCLEAN, Va., April 10, 2026 -- Cycurion, Inc. (Nasdaq: CYCU) (“Cycurion” or the “Company”), a leading provider of advanced IT cybersecurity solutions and AI-driven innovations for government, enterprise, and critical infrastructure clients, today continues to make it clear that it will not sit idly by and will vigorously investigate anyone involved in manipulating the price of the Company’s stock. In the latest step, Cycurion has issued litigation hold letters (formal evidence preservation) to 16 prominent market makers and securities firms, putting them on immediate notice to preserve all evidence of trading activity in the Company’s stock as part of an ongoing investigation into potential market manipulation.
The litigation hold letters, issued in connection with the Superior Court of Justice, Wake County, North Carolina (File No. 26CV012490-910) in the action Cycurion, Inc. f/k/a WAVS v. ACCESS Newswire Inc. and John Doe One, formally require each recipient to preserve and not destroy, alter, or delete any records related to trading in shares of Cycurion, Inc. (Nasdaq: CYCU) during the period February 16, 2026 through March 23, 2026. This includes all buy and sell orders, execution details, counterparty information, communications, customer account details (including KYC), surveillance reports, exception reports, internal investigations, margin and collateral records, order lifecycle data, bid/ask quotes, spread data, Consolidated Audit Trail information, and any Suspicious Activity Reports (SARs).

This latest action builds upon the Company’s recent success in unmasking Michael S. Emo as the individual previously named as John Doe 1 and John Doe 2 in the Company’s defamation lawsuit pending in Alexandria, Virginia.
